Willkommen in der Howtos Sektion von OpenPHPNuke - das Open Source CMS


OpenPHPnuke

Tutorials zu OpenPHPnuke

Umzug der Webseite auf der shell



Hier mal ein kurzes HowTo um eine OPN Webseite von einem Server auf einen anderen zu kopieren.
Voraussetzung ist hier zu allerdings ein shell Zugang auf den Webservern.

Zu erst kopieren wir alle Files von dem alten Server auf den Neuen. Ich nutze dazu FTP. Genuer
mc. Die ist die Verbindung mit einem FTP Link möglich. Es gibt allerdings auch noch viele weitere
Möglichkeiten.

Jetzt sollten wir noch die DB in der alten Installtion sichern. Das können wir schnell und einfach auf der shell mit

# /usr/bin/mysqldump --opt --complete-insert --add-drop-table --lock-tables --quick --user={deindatenbankuser} --password={deinpasswort} --host=localhost {deindatenbankname} > datenbank.sql

erledigen. Auch das kopieren wir schnell auf den neuen Server.

Jetzt sind wir auf dem alten Server fertig und gehen auf den neuen. Hier wechseln wir in das entsprechende Verzeichniss.
Da wir per FTP kopiert haben und den "richtigen" Benutzer genutzt haben sollten die Files den richtigen Benutzer haben.
Auch die Rechte sollten stimmen.

Stimmt der Benutzer nicht können wir das schnell mit

# chown -R {deinbenutzer}:{deinegruppe} *
# chown -R {deinbenutzer}:{deinegruppe} *.*

ändern.

So jetzt spielen wir die Datenbank wieder ein.

mysql -u{deindatenbankuser} -p{deinpasswort} -hlocalhost {deindatenbankname} < datenbank.sql

Jetz passen wir die mainfile.php noch entsprechend an.

Jetzt ist das reine Kopieren getan. Sofern sich der path nicht geändert hat ist nur noch die mainfile.php entsprechend anzupassen.
Allerdings ändert sich bei einem Server Umzug fast immer der path. Aber auch das können wir automatisch OPN weit korrigieren lassen.

# cd opn-bin
# ./new_domain.php -path -old{web_path} -new{web_path}

Damit sind alle Aufgaben erledigt und der Umzug abgeschlossen.




Extra Information....
zugefügt am: 22.08.2010 11:26
Verfasser Stefan ()
Bewertung (gelesen: 10129 mal)
Option: Drucken Drucken mit Kommentar
Es sind keine Kommentare für Gäste erlaubt, bitte registrieren Sie sich


[ Zurück zum Howtos Index ]